Coverage for an FTE leave on the Global Football Chassis team. They’ll focus on game day uniforms for soccer teams. Chassis focuses on the fit and performance of the uniform, a blend of fit/design and pattern/design; the stylized version of garment blocks. They will translate creative sketches from designers to technical drawings for cut and sew expression. Looking for creativity through technical skills.
